    I had the pad thai once at the location near UT and thought it was a mushy mess so it took me a long time to try MM again. And I avoid now the pad thai, but every other dish I've here has been delicious! Looking through the reviews here, lots of the low ones seem to be about service or takeout. I haven't experienced bad service personally. My go to is the Khao soi noodles. This bowl is MASSIVE and the soup is thick and super flavorful. It's really really really good, trust me on this one. Of course much more expensive than the bowl I had in Chiang Mai, but man I'm happy with this dish here. I always have lots of leftover soup to take home and give it a second life. The Tom kha gai is also very flavorful. It is the perfect appetite-opener to me. And their curries are great too. My only complaint about their curries is while the meat chunks are good, I wish there were more other vegetables. For my partner who is a total carnivore, he doesn't mind this. But I want more of a balance of meat and veg in my curries. The nuer ob is pretty good - lots of tender beef chunks in a very tasty gravy made of onion, tomato, soy sauce and I'm not sure what else. This to me is similar to a Chinese braise. The crying tiger beef (sorry I don't have a picture) is also a winner. Good quality beef, and gotta love the dipping sauce. The prices can sometimes feel high but the portion sizes are big and that's just what food costs these days.
